Senior Fullstack Engineer - £120K - TS, React, Next.js - Remote UK (1-day p/month in London) A pioneering

LegalTech

start-up is transforming access to legal services for consumers and small businesses, offering affordable solutions powered by a combination of human expertise and advanced AI technology. Backed by prominent US and UK venture funds, they are on a mission to level the playing field in legal accessibility after recently announcing $40m in Series-A Investment. Role Overview The company is hiring

Senior Full Stack Engineers

to develop its innovative platform, websites, and AI-driven products. This role involves collaborating with a dynamic team to deliver user-focused, technically complex systems. You will play a pivotal role in scaling their platform and integrating cutting-edge AI research into practical applications. Key Responsibilities Develop and maintain full-stack features using TypeScript, React, Node.js, and Next.js Solve technical challenges and influence product design decisions Ensure high-quality code and adherence to best practices in security, testing, and development Build scalable, user-centric products in a fast-paced, product-driven environment Tech Stack Frontend:

React, Next.js, Tailwind Backend:

Node.js, Prisma, tRPC Database:

PostgreSQL, MongoDB, Redis Infrastructure:

Serverless, AWS, Terraform Data Tools:

DBT, BigQuery Requirements Minimum of 5-years experience (but likely more) Proven experience delivering high-quality, modern applications in a fast-paced environment. Expertise across the stack, particularly with TypeScript and React. Experience working in product-led teams and contributing to impactful user-focused decisions. Strong organisational skills and attention to detail. Degree in Computer Science or a STEM subject Location & Benefits Remote-first

with occasional travel to London (1 day/month). Competitive salary (£100-120K) based on experience. Opportunity to shape the future of legal tech in a supportive, ambitious team. This role is ideal for engineers passionate about using technology to create meaningful societal impact.
